Default RC Motorsports Nashville, TN

the first race is Oval Friday the 24th doors open at 5 racing at 7

bring a barstool if you don't want to stand.

Saturday is Onroad doors open at 10am racing at 2pm

entry is $15 first and $10 for additional

Three heats and a main

Check out the website www.rcmotorsportsracing.com for pictures of the track and map

810 CHEROKEE AVE in the back warehouse of MID-STATE PAPER & NOTION

take exit 87 Trinity Lane off I-65 go east (coming south 65 go left - coming north 65 go right) go to the third light take a Right on Jones Ave, go two blocks to Cherokee Ave, turn left. (the sign for Cherokee is on the right) go half a block down to the first warehouse on the right (says Midsouth on the front). turn right between the warehouses go to the back and the door is in the back.

questions call Chuck 615-642-5900

Is the oval banked or flat? The pics look like it is being put down flat. What kind of carpet did they use?

it's flat... the carpet is the same basic carpet at the smoky mtn track fanfair or whatever you call it... it's the carpet that was used at our indoor carpet track in cool springs a year or so ago. It's already been run on some and should be hooked up once a few laps are put on it.

The onroad track is on the GOOD stuff. CRC Ozite... it doesn't fuzz and has traction from the start....
